Written Answers. - School Transport.

Austin Deasy

Ceist:

255 Mr. Deasy asked the Minister for Education if she will make special arrangements for the transport of a child (details supplied) in County Waterford, in view of her severe disability, and the necessity for individual attention.

As this child cannot be catered for adequately on a primary school special bus service, my Department are investigating the possibility of accommodating her on a post-primary service. Should such an arrangement prove unworkable my Department would be in a position to offer the family a grant towards the cost of private transport.
